#95efaf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#95efaf is composed of 58.4% red, 93.7% green and 68.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 37.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 26.8% yellow and 6.3% black. It has a hue angle of 137.3 degrees, a saturation of 73.8% and a lightness of 76.1%. #95efaf color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#2bdf5f. Closest websafe color is: #99ff99.

Shades and Tints of #95efaf

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020d05 is the darkest color, while #fbfefc is the lightest one.

Tones of #95efaf

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#bfc5c1 is the less saturated color, while #87fda9 is the most saturated one.
